海南小黄姜脱毒快繁技术研究

扫码查看
以海南小黄姜茎尖为材料,进行组培脱毒及离体快繁技术研究,结果表明,剥离茎尖(0.3~0.5 mm)分生组织培养,能有效脱除生姜烟草花叶病毒和黄瓜花叶病毒。筛选出适合丛生芽分化的培养基配方(MS+6-BA3.0 mg/L+NAA0.1 mg/L),实现了生姜增殖与生根诱导同步,增殖系数为8,将试管苗移栽到沙土+椰糠1:1的混合基质中炼苗,成活率最高为92%。
Virus Elimination and Rapid Propagation of Small Yellow Ginger (Zingiber officinale Rosc) in Hainan
In order to investigate virus elimination and micropropagation of ginger, we use small yellow ginger stem tissue as material. The results showed with stem tip (0.3~0.5 mm) culture, could effectively remove Tobacco mosaic virus and Cucumber mosaic virus of ginger, which showed the medium MS+6-BA3.0 mg/L+NAA0.1 mg/L were best for buds propagation, we accomplished the proliferation and root induction synchronised, the propagation coefficient were 8 , transplant to hardening in sand+coconut husk 1:1 mixing matrix had the best transplanting survival rate were 92%.
